With the rapid development of biotechnology, drug research and development has gradually entered a new era of precision and personalization. Targeted Protein Degradation (TPD) drugs are an emerging therapeutic strategy that utilizes the body's ubiquitin-proteasome system to degrade specific pathological proteins to achieve precise treatment. Drug affinity responsive target stability is a label-free small molecule probe technique under chemical proteomics first proposed by Lomenick et al. in 2009, which makes it possible to track and identify target proteins whose stability changes after binding with small molecules.
